> > > Halfway between having uncompressed the kernel and starting init, the console
> > > starts to scroll "atkbd.c: Unknown key pressed", mentioning key code 0 (IIRC),
> > > even though no keys are pressed at all. After a while, the scrolling stops,
> > > but the keyboard still doesn't work. 2.4 works fine on the same hardware.
> > >
> > > Hardware is an Intel SE7505VB2 board with dual 2.40GHz Xeon processors,
> > > and a Logitech PS/2 "Internet keyboard."
